About Gracetown 6284

The size of Gracetown is approximately 32.6 square kilometres. It has 2 parks covering nearly 91.1% of total area. The population of Gracetown in 2011 was 472 people. By 2016 the population was 221 showing a population decline of 53.2%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Gracetown is 40-49 years. Households in Gracetown are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Gracetown work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 67.8% of the homes in Gracetown were owner-occupied compared with 65.5% in 2016.
